Estimated Price Range
Stonework installation projects in Kirkland, WA typically range from $1,200 - $2,800 for smaller scope jobs.
Prices vary depending on project size, materials, and complexity, with larger projects costing more.
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Patio | $2,000 - $5,000 |
| Fireplace Surround | $1,500 - $4,000 |
| Retaining Wall | $3,000 - $8,000 |
| Walkway | $1,200 - $3,500 |
| Kitchen Backsplash | $800 - $2,500 |
| Countertops | $2,500 - $7,000 |
Factors Influencing Cost
Stonework installation projects in Kirkland, WA, can vary widely based on materials, scope, and complexity. Understanding typical factors involved can help in planning and comparing options for stone features such as patios, retaining walls, or decorative accents. This overview provides a neutral look at common considerations for stonework projects in the area.
- Materials: Options include natural stone, manufactured stone, and veneer, each with different textures and costs suitable for various aesthetic preferences.
- Size and Scope: Projects may range from small accent features to large-scale patios or retaining walls, impacting overall project complexity and duration.
- Labor Complexity: Installation difficulty depends on the type of stone, design intricacy, and site conditions, influencing labor requirements and costs.
- Permitting: Some stonework projects, especially structural elements like retaining walls over certain heights, may require local permits in Kirkland, WA.
- Additional Features: Extras such as sealing, finishing, or integrating lighting can add to project scope and overall expense.
Project Size and Scope
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small accents or repairs | $500 - $2,000 |
| Walkways and patios (up to 200 sq ft) | $2,000 - $8,000 |
| Fireplaces or feature walls | $4,000 - $15,000 |
| Large retaining walls (over 200 sq ft) | $10,000 - $30,000+ |
